I paused over the scenario of a coalition collapse last night....considering who'd replace Merz in the voting situation.
First, the coalition is 'fairly' safe at present, and have a 'grace-period'....to emerge out of the recession period. I doubt this collapse would occur in 2026....odds increase in 2027.
Top three candidates?
Jens Spahn (CDU) - Leader of the CDU/CSU parliamentary group in the Bundestag. On debate skills....one of the top three from the entire Bundestag.
Markus Söder (CSU) - Chairman of the CSU and Minister-President of Bavaria.
Thorsten Frei (CDU) - Head of the Chancellery (Chief of Staff).
Wildcard? Julia Klöckner (CDU), the current President of the Bundestag. The current President of Germany, Frank-Walter Steinmeier....wraps up his era in Feb 2027, and I suspect Klöckner might be replacing Steinmeier.
